Output f8d1dc7e4fe7803a771408d58ebef46e4ef3fe1ceba6bdfd9bb1cc5aafa57ec8:9

value
627000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7c05bcd4787daf72ebd17148bba05fe2c62b6b7 OP_EQUAL
address
3QH1GEdQzLSCssDWefeh7NW33ECetag4ts
transaction
f8d1dc7e4fe7803a771408d58ebef46e4ef3fe1ceba6bdfd9bb1cc5aafa57ec8
confirmations
100226
spent
true